Announcement

Collapse
No announcement yet.

RADV Vulkan Driver Can Now Correctly Render Talos Principle

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

  • #21
    actually I just pushed a fix to support srgb and unorm to the branch, it works with talos and dota2 now.

    Comment


    • #22
      Originally posted by schmidtbag View Post
      I don't fully understand why the development of this is so fast (compared to how OpenGL specs are so slow)
      opengl specs are much larger and radv reuses much of already written code for opengl or for other drivers

      Comment


      • #23
        Originally posted by pal666 View Post
        opengl specs are much larger and radv reuses much of already written code for opengl or for other drivers
        Mostly low level code like Gallium. Probably same functions - different names.

        Comment


        • #24
          Originally posted by liam View Post
          Would it be possible to run these benchmarks with the ultra setting, or is radv not yet able to do that?
          Looking at haagch video (and ignoring bright picture), there are some artifacts so still misrender on ultra

          Comment


          • #25
            No need to ignore the bright picture now: https://www.youtube.com/watch?v=GltTu_BA7rc

            Yes, ultra gpu speed is still buggy. The rest looks okay. Frame times on high are pretty bad. :/

            Comment


            • #26
              This is awesome. Seems like I'll be able to use both GPUs to render games sooner than expected!

              Comment


              • #27
                I see that some people can run Talos with a 7970...

                Do the game work or just the benchmark? I ask because I tried and well, the menu work fine in Vulkan but it crash when I try to start to game to play. I did not try the bench mode as I have about 30% chance of getting a system wide crash.

                Most vulkan demo and the totally useless vulkan triangle I programmed work fine.

                Comment


                • #28
                  Edit??

                  The problem I got seam to come from amdgpu. Talos is still crashy on OpenGL. It's playable but exiting Menus sometime will kill X.

                  Will go look to fix that.

                  Sep 27 17:44:43 Tanith kernel: WARNING: CPU: 1 PID: 3794 at drivers/gpu/drm/drm_irq.c:1168 drm_vblank_put+0xa7/0xb0 [drm]
                  Sep 27 17:44:43 Tanith kernel: drm_kms_helper snd_pcm cfbfillrect cfbimgblt cfbcopyarea snd_timer ttm r8169 snd drm mii soundcore i2c_core syscopyarea sysfillrect sysimgblt fb_sys_fops backlight fb fbdev unix
                  Sep 27 17:44:43 Tanith kernel: [<ffffffffa0089337>] drm_vblank_put+0xa7/0xb0 [drm]
                  Sep 27 17:44:43 Tanith kernel: [<ffffffffa0089352>] drm_crtc_vblank_put+0x12/0x20 [drm]
                  Sep 27 17:44:43 Tanith kernel: [<ffffffffa00a2c37>] drm_mode_page_flip_ioctl+0x1b7/0x490 [drm]
                  Sep 27 17:44:43 Tanith kernel: [<ffffffffa0087f35>] drm_ioctl+0x225/0x4c0 [drm]
                  Sep 27 17:44:43 Tanith kernel: [<ffffffffa00a2a80>] ? drm_mode_cursor2_ioctl+0x10/0x10 [drm]
                  Sep 27 17:44:43 Tanith kernel: [<ffffffffa0212047>] amdgpu_drm_ioctl+0x47/0x80 [amdgpu]

                  Comment


                  • #29
                    My result with windows, yes windows opengl is slower,
                    full hd, high\med\high\none (most high and stable settings for me)
                    Linux Windows
                    OpenGL 72 57
                    Vulkan 111 135
                    dx11 144

                    Comment


                    • #30
                      Originally posted by dungeon View Post

                      Looking at haagch video (and ignoring bright picture), there are some artifacts so still misrender on ultra

                      Thanks for the response.
                      Yup, no point in looking at performance too closely until it renders everything properly.

                      Comment

                      Working...
                      X